How much does it cost to rent an apartment in San Mateo Town Center?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| San Mateo Town Center Studio Apartments | $2,813 | $1,875 | $3,515 |
| San Mateo Town Center 1 Bedroom Apartments | $3,570 | $2,150 | $9,030 |
San Mateo Town Center 2 Bedroom Apartments | $4,568 | $2,650 | $10,000+ |
| San Mateo Town Center 3 Bedroom Apartments | $5,377 | $4,443 | $6,961 |
